Aged 18, three young women find themselves living together at university. Three strong personalities, three different lives combine to create an invincible trio. Di and Viv and Rose is a funny and honest exploration of the impacts friendships have on life, and vice versa. This heartwarming three-hander is the perfect way to inject some warmth into your otherwise chilly new year!
Starring Tamsin Outhwaite, stage fave Jenna Russell and Samantha Spiro, this play was given the thumbs up when it was staged at the Hampstead Theatre in 2013. A perfect nostalgic treat to see with your old university friends (or even your current ones!).
Di and Viv and Rose is Amelia Bullmore's newest play since her award-winning Mammals, which won the Susan Smith Blackburn Prize and subsequently was taken on a national tour.

Di played by Tamzin Outhwaite
Viv played by Samantha Spiro
Rose played by Jenna Russell
Author - Amelia Bullmore
Director - Anna Mackmin
Designer - Paul Wills
Lighting - Oliver Fenwick
Sound - Simon Baker
